The Role of Tree Pruning in Maintaining Healthy Trees
Tree pruning plays a crucial role in maintaining the health and vitality of your trees. By removing dead or diseased branches and promoting proper growth, pruning not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of your landscape but also ensures the overall well-being of your trees. Regular pruning is considered an essential part of tree care services, providing numerous benefits that contribute to the long-term health and longevity of your trees.
Improved Tree Structure: Proper pruning techniques help shape and guide the growth of trees, creating a sturdy and well-structured canopy. By eliminating weak or crossing branches, pruning reduces the risk of structural issues such as breakage during storms or heavy winds.
Enhanced Air Circulation and Sunlight Penetration: Pruning allows for better air circulation within the canopy, reducing the chances of fungal diseases. It also opens up the canopy, allowing sunlight to reach the lower branches and the ground, fostering the growth of vibrant understory plants and maintaining a healthy ecosystem.
Increased Fruit Production: Pruning fruit trees encourages the development of stronger branches and promotes better flowering and fruit production. It helps remove congested branches, allowing for improved air circulation, sunlight exposure, and increased nutrient availability.
Prevention of Pest and Disease Infestations: Regular pruning entails the removal of dead and diseased branches, reducing the likelihood of pest infestations and the spread of diseases. It creates a healthier environment for the trees, making them more resistant to common pests and diseases.
Safe and Aesthetically Pleasing Landscape: Properly pruned trees not only enhance the visual appeal of your property but also ensure safety. By removing deadwood and potential hazards, pruning minimizes the risk of falling branches and limb failures, keeping your surroundings safe for both people and property.

Common Deadwood Removal Techniques
When it comes to tree trimming and maintenance, deadwood removal plays a crucial role in ensuring the health and safety of your trees. Deadwood refers to branches or limbs that have died and are no longer functional. It is important to identify and eliminate deadwood promptly to prevent potential hazards and promote the overall well-being of your trees.
There are several common techniques that tree trimmers employ to effectively remove deadwood. Let’s take a closer look at some of these best practices:
- Selective Pruning: This technique involves the targeted removal of dead or diseased branches from a tree. By selectively pruning the affected areas, tree trimmers can eliminate deadwood and improve the tree’s overall structure and appearance.
- Crown Cleaning: Crown cleaning focuses on removing deadwood from the upper portion or crown of a tree. This technique helps enhance the tree’s aesthetics, reduces the risk of falling debris, and promotes air circulation and sunlight penetration.
- Thinning: Thinning involves the removal of specific branches within the crown of a tree to reduce density and weight. By selectively thinning the tree’s canopy, deadwood can be eliminated, reducing the risk of branch failure and improving overall tree health.
- Cabling and Bracing: In cases where a tree has structural weakness or potential for limb failure, cabling and bracing techniques can be employed. These methods involve using cables or braces to support weak branches or limbs, reducing the risk of damage or hazards caused by deadwood.
- Complete Removal: In severe cases where deadwood poses a significant risk to the tree or its surroundings, complete removal may be necessary. Tree trimmers carefully assess the situation and determine if complete removal is the best course of action to ensure safety and preserve the tree’s health.

Assessing Tree Health and Structural Stability
Before initiating deadwood removal, it is crucial to assess the health and structural stability of the trees. This assessment ensures not only the safety of the tree trimmers but also the long-term well-being of the trees. Tree trimming companies play a vital role in conducting thorough evaluations to identify potential risks and determine the appropriate course of action.
During the assessment process, tree care services professionals carefully examine various factors that can affect tree health and stability. These factors include:
- Presence of diseased or decaying branches
- Cracks or splits in the trunk or major limbs
- Signs of insect infestation or disease
- Root system health and stability
- Overall structural integrity
By evaluating these aspects, tree trimming experts can make informed decisions regarding deadwood removal. They can identify the extent of decay or damage, determine the risk of falling branches, and assess the overall structural stability of the tree.
Additionally, tree care professionals may use specialized tools such as tree seismograph to measure the density of wood and identify hidden decay or rot. This advanced technology allows for a comprehensive evaluation of the tree’s internal condition, enabling precise deadwood removal techniques.

Safety Measures During Deadwood Removal
When it comes to deadwood removal during tree trimming, safety should always be the top priority. Implementing the right safety measures not only protects the tree trimmers but also ensures a safe environment for everyone involved. Here are some crucial safety considerations that tree trimming experts follow:
1. Proper Safety Gear
Tree trimming experts understand the importance of wearing appropriate safety gear to minimize the risk of accidents or injuries. This includes:
- Protective helmets to safeguard against falling debris.
- Eye protection to shield the eyes from wood chips and dust.
- Gloves for a firm grip and protection against cuts.
- Non-slip footwear to maintain stability while working at heights.
2. Correct Cutting Techniques
Avoiding incorrect cutting techniques not only ensures the safety of the tree trimmers but also promotes healthy tree growth. Some essential cutting techniques to follow during deadwood removal include:
- Using proper pruning tools and equipment.
- Employing the three-cut method to avoid bark tearing.
- Removing deadwood in sections to prevent tree damage.
3. Fall Protection Measures
Since tree trimming often involves working at heights, fall protection measures are critical to ensuring the safety of tree trimmers. Some fall protection strategies include:
- Using harnesses and safety lanyards.
- Securing ropes and climbing gear to stable anchor points.
- Bracing or cabling weak branches to enhance stability.

Maintaining Tree Health After Deadwood Removal
After the removal of deadwood from your trees, it is crucial to prioritize tree health and implement proper maintenance measures. This will not only support the recovery process but also help prevent future issues. Here are some essential tips to ensure the well-being of your trees:
1. Proper Wound Care
After deadwood removal, trees are left with wounds that need proper care to promote healing. Apply a suitable tree wound dressing to protect against disease and infestation. Consult a professional tree care service to determine the appropriate dressing for your specific tree species.
2. Regular Watering
Provide adequate water to help your trees recover from the stress of deadwood removal. Water deeply, ensuring the moisture reaches the tree’s root zone. Regular watering during the recovery period is essential for maintaining tree health.
3. Mulching
Apply a layer of organic mulch around the base of your trees to conserve moisture, regulate soil temperature, and suppress weed growth. Make sure to leave a gap around the trunk to prevent moisture buildup and potential rotting.
4. Fertilization
Consider fertilizing your trees to replenish essential nutrients and support their recovery. Consult a tree care professional to determine the appropriate fertilizer and application method based on your tree’s specific needs.
5. Regular Inspections
Continuously monitor your trees for signs of stress, disease, or pests. Regular inspections allow for early detection and prompt intervention to mitigate potential problems.
